On average across the year,
yes, El Salvador is hotter than
Luxembourg
.
El Salvador has an average temperature of 26°C/79°F and Luxembourg has an average temperature of 10°C/50°F.
El Salvador's hottest month is April,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F, which is hotter than Luxembourg's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 23°C/73°F).
On average across the year, no, El Salvador is not colder than Luxembourg . El Salvador has an average minimum temperature of 21°C/70°F and Luxembourg has an average minimum temperature of 7°C/45°F.
On average across the year,
no, El Salvador has less rain than
Luxembourg. El Salvador has an average annual rainfall of 400mm and Luxembourg has an average annual rainfall of 863mm.
El Salvador's wettest month is August, with an average monthly rainfall of 87mm, which is drier than Luxembourg's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 92mm).

Yes, El Salvador is bigger than Luxembourg.
El Salvador has an area of 20,721 km2 (53,667 miles2) and Luxembourg has an area of 2,586 km2 (6,698 miles2)
which means that El Salvador is 18,135 km2 (46,970 miles2) bigger than Luxembourg.
That makes El Salvador 8 times bigger than Luxembourg.

Yes, El Salvador is more populated than Luxembourg.
El Salvador has a population of 6,568,745 and Luxembourg has a population of 650,364
which means that El Salvador has 5,918,381 more people than Luxembourg.
That makes El Salvador 10 times more populated than Luxembourg.
